Wrongful death lawsuits are another important aspect of mesothelioma litigation. These lawsuits are brought by family members who have suffered the loss of a loved one because of asbestos exposure. Families may be entitled compensation for funeral costs or loss of companionship, among other damages.

Depending on the state, the victims and their families may be eligible for compensation from asbestos trust funds. These trusts were created by the bankruptcy of asbestos-producing companies or asbestos-using ones. These trusts are intended to protect assets that could be used to pay asbestos-related legal costs. The money that these trusts receive can substantially increase the amount of mesothelioma settlements. Many asbestos-exposed companies have gone bankrupt, and cannot be sued. A mesothelioma lawyer who is specialized in these cases will be familiar with the bankruptcy trusts and will know how to help their clients get compensation from these funds.
